WebMar 7, 2024 · Hi, hope I can get some help here. I want to implement unsupervised contrastive learning model MoCo in TF2, but I have no idea how to implement the essential trick mentioned in the paper - Shuffling BN. I think I understand what shuffling BN does, but I don’t know any APIs to fetch different data slices from each GPU, shuffle them, and send … WebDefine shuffling. shuffling synonyms, shuffling pronunciation, shuffling translation, English dictionary definition of shuffling. v. shuf·fled , shuf·fling , shuf·fles v. intr. 1. To move with …
How to Implement Shuffle BN for MoCo in Tensorflow 2
WebMar 20, 2024 · We don't use shuffle BN in Barlow Twins. We use global BN, instead. The code should, therefore, work the same (ignoring randomness and machine precision … http://www.iotword.com/6055.html corporate cost of borrowing
Efficient implementation of Shuffle BN in MoCo? - PyTorch Forums
WebApr 12, 2024 · 2.1 Oct-Conv 复现. 为了同时做到同一频率内的更新和不同频率之间的交流,卷积核分成四部分:. 高频到高频的卷积核. 高频到低频的卷积核. 低频到高频的卷积核. 低频到低频的卷积核. 下图直观地展示了八度卷积的卷积核,可以看出四个部分共同组成了大小为 … WebMay 29, 2024 · shuffle BN:moco用的异步batch norm 即在各自node里计算batch norm, BN的参数不在node间共享。对此他们的解决方法是在encode前交换node中的数据,因 … WebThe mean and standard-deviation are calculated per-dimension over all mini-batches of the same process groups. γ \gamma γ and β \beta β are learnable parameter vectors of size C (where C is the input size). By default, the elements of γ \gamma γ are sampled from U (0, 1) \mathcal{U}(0, 1) U (0, 1) and the elements of β \beta β are set to 0. The standard … corporate cost control clearwater fl